Mafic-ultramafic massif, consisting mainly of mantle peridotites (harzburgite and minor lherzolite) and minor dyke-like dunite bodies, pyroxenite and gabbro.

Located in the western YZSZ, the Purang ophiolite trends NW-SE and is about 60 km east–west and 20 km north–south. It consists primarily of harzburgitic mantle peridotite intruded by mafic dikes, with minor dunite and lherzolite lenses. The Purang ophiolite contains localized small-scale (1–10 m long, 0.5–6 m wide) massive or disseminated chromitite mineralization.
